Haiti squad announced for the Sud Ladies Cup 2019

The Haitian Football Federation (FHF) has announced the final 21 players squad for the Sud Ladies Cup 2019 held from 8th to 18th May.

Goalkeepers

Madelina Fleuriot (Exafoot)
Edjenie Joseph (AS Tigresses)
Nahomie Ambroise (Anacaona SC)

Defenders

Tabita Dougenie Kerbie Joseph (AS Tigresses)
Ruthny Mathurin (AS Tigresses)
Esthericové Joseph (Exafoot)
Rose Pierreline France (ASF Croix-Des-Bousquets)
Méghane St-Cyr (CSSH - CAN)

Midfielders

Nancy Lindor (Exafoot)
Angeline Gustave (AS Tigresses)
Dieunica Jean-Baptiste (Aigle Brillant AC)
Monique Danielle Étienne (New York City Soccer Club – USA)
Bethina Petit-Frère (Exafoot)
Dayana Pierre-Louis (ASF Croix-Des-Bousquets)
Maudeline Moryl (Anacaona SC)

Forwards

Abaina Louis (AS Tigresses)
Florcie-Love Darlina Joseph (Don Bosco FC)
Rachelle Caremus (Aigle Brillant AC)
Valentina Ornis (ASF Croix-Des-Bousquets)
Rose-Alya Marcellus (ASF Croix-Des-Bousquets)
Maille Jean (AS Tigresses)

As a reminder, Haiti will face Gabon (8 May), France (10 May), Mexico (12 May), Japan (15 May) and DPR Korea (18 May).
